Vio0

You're wrong, xG doesn't take the quality of the finishing into account and is inflated by taking many low quality chances. For measuring finishing quality, you can compare xG and xGot (or xG post shot).

EasyModeActivist

No it measures the odds of a shot going in. It doesn't account for players shooting early when they could've gone closer to goal, or shooting late once they fuck up a first touch, chances not resulting in shots because of passes just barely not connecting, narrow offsides etc. xG isn't a completely useless metric, but it's not a stat about chances, it's one about shots.
